实现 IDEA 最低 Java 版本的过程指南
在 Java 开发中,有时我们需要设定项目所使用的最低 Java 版本,以保证代码的兼容性和稳定性。下面,将通过一个简单而详细的步骤指南,教你如何在 IntelliJ IDEA 中设置最低 Java 版本。
流程概述
步骤 | 描述 |
---|---|
1 | 创建新的 Java 项目 |
2 | 配置项目 SDK |
3 | 修改 pom.xml (如果使用 Maven) |
4 | 修改 build.gradle (如果使用 Gradle) |
5 | 编写代码并测试 |
flowchart TD
A[创建新 Java 项目] --> B[配置项目 SDK]
B --> C{使用 Maven?}
C -->|是| D[修改 pom.xml]
C -->|否| E[修改 build.gradle]
D --> F[编写代码并测试]
E --> F
1. 创建新的 Java 项目
在 IntelliJ IDEA 中,你可以选择“File” > “New” > “Project”,然后选择 Java 项目。填写必要的项目信息,并完成项目创建。
2. 配置项目 SDK
进入“File” > “Project Structure”,在“Project”选项中,你将看到 “Project SDK”。如果没有合适的 SDK,点击 “New” 按钮来添加一个新的 Java SDK。
代码示例:
// 这里不需要具体代码,通过IDEA界面设置即可
3. 修改 pom.xml
(如果使用 Maven)
如果你的项目使用 Maven 可以在 pom.xml
文件中指定最低 Java 版本。
在 pom.xml
中添加以下配置:
<properties>
<maven.compiler.source>1.8</maven.compiler.source> <!-- 设置源版本为 Java 1.8 -->
<maven.compiler.target>1.8</maven.compiler.target> <!-- 设置目标版本为 Java 1.8 -->
</properties>
4. 修改 build.gradle
(如果使用 Gradle)
如果你的项目使用 Gradle,可以在 build.gradle
文件中设置最低 Java 版本。
在 build.gradle
文件中添加以下配置:
plugins {
id 'java'
}
java {
sourceCompatibility = '1.8' // 设置源版本为 Java 1.8
targetCompatibility = '1.8' // 设置目标版本为 Java 1.8
}
5. 编写代码并测试
在完成上述步骤后,就可以开始编写代码并进行测试了。确保你写的代码不会使用高于所设置版本的特性。
public class Main {
public static void main(String[] args) {
System.out.println("Hello, Java 1.8!"); // 打印信息
}
}
评估设置
通过下面的饼状图,我们可以清晰地看到设置最低版本的方案中,项目构建工具的选择。
pie
title 项目构建工具选择
"Maven": 50
"Gradle": 30
"其他": 20
结论
成功设置 IntelliJ IDEA 项目的最低 Java 版本并不复杂。通过简单的几个步骤,你能够保证你的项目符合特定的代码要求。无论你选择 Maven 还是 Gradle,只需在相应的配置文件中设置源与目标版本就可以了。希望本指南能够帮助你在 Java 开发路上取得更大的进步与成长!